CD Multichanger fault
Hi all
I've just joined this club and wondered if anyone had experienced the problem I have. My CD Multichanger has power and ejects the CD carrier every time the eject button is pressed. When no CD carrier is installed this is displayed on the highline window. When the carrier is loaded with 6 CDs and inserted into the CD player, a few whirring sounds are heard, but the disc does not seem to be selected and taken from the carrier into the player and the display on the highline does not recognise any discs as being present. This has happened a few times since I've owned the car from new, but in the past by ejecting the carrier and removing/re-installing the discs into the carrier, it has cured the problem. This time, however, it's not doing anything. I have removed the use to try and reset the Multichanger, but without success. I wondered if anyone had any ideas or do I need to source another CD Multichanger? The car is an MG ZT 190+ SE and the Multichanger was factory fitted. I do not know the make, but can probably research this if it helps. Many thanks. |

When my CD cartridge got stuck I used to bash it with a rubber hammer handle, that shifts it...
Open the door, then hold the button down while you bash it, it should pop out OK.. ... |
